Pericarditis and inflammatory bowel disease.

D G Thompson, J E Lennard-Jones, E T Swarbrick, R Bown.   

Abstract

Pericarditis is an uncommon but important complication of inflammatory bowel disease. Five new cases are described and the published literature on nine other cases is reviewed. The pericarditis occurred during an active phase of the colitis in all our cases and was associated with other extra-colonic manifestations of colitis in three. No other cause for the pericarditis was identified and in all five cases it responded promptly to the administration of corticosteroid drugs.
